History

Settlement there goes back to at least the Celtic period. In the twelfth century, the name "Viriacus" appears in a record, referring to church and a priory.

Twin towns

Viriat is twinned with: * Voinești, Vaslui, Romania, since 1989 * Sorbolo, Italy, since 2000
